    I also have to say, a split stay is a super idea and you can absolutely do that, you'd just need to make two separate reservations. One of the best things about splitting your stay within the properties at Walt Disney World is that you'll get two completely different Resort experiences. The way I figure it, the more the merrier! Now, here's the best part. On the morning that you're checking out of your first stay, you simply go to bell services with your luggage and let them know that you'd like it transferred to your next Resort and they'll take care of the rest! Your luggage will normally arrive within 3-4 hours and once you drop it off, you're free to go enjoy your day with no worries! They'll hold your luggage for you at bell services at your next Resort and you can just stop by to pick it up on your way in. If you're too tired for that, you can just call down from your room and have it brought up as well.
